您好,我想默认选择列表中的第一项。因此,当我打开视图时,我希望默认选择Général下的 Plafondsécuritésociale 。
当我打开视图时,似乎我的项目已被选中,但它很快又关闭并且我正在使用Jquery 3.3.1
$(function () {
$(".a.mdc-list-item:first").one("click", function (event) {
event.preventDefault();
});
});
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<div class="col-12">
<div class="container">
<div class="row">
<div class="col-12">
<a class="mdc-list-item" style="width:100%;margin-right:3px;margin-left:3px;">
<div class="col-sm">
<div class="row" data-toggle="collapse" data-target="#général" style="cursor:pointer">
<span class="user" style="font-weight:bold">Général</span>
</div>
</div>
<div class="col-sm">
<div class="col-md-1 chevron-down" data-toggle="collapse" data-target="#général" style="float:right;margin-right:0px">
<i class="général_arrow material-icons float-right material-expand ripple" style="color: #0047FD !important;">
expand_more
</i>
</div>
</div>
</a>
</div>
</div>
</div>
<div id="général" class="collapse">
<div class="container">
<div class="row">
<div class="col-12">
<a class="mdc-list-item" tauxPlafonds="PSS" data-toggle="tooltip" data-placement="top" style="cursor:pointer;">
Plafond sécurité sociale
</a>
<a class="mdc-list-item" tauxPlafonds="SMIC" data-toggle="tooltip" data-placement="top" style="cursor:pointer;">
Smic
</a>
<a class="mdc-list-item" tauxPlafonds="CSG" data-toggle="tooltip" data-placement="top" style="cursor:pointer;">
CSG CRDS
</a>
<a class="mdc-list-item" tauxPlafonds="AGM" data-toggle="tooltip" data-placement="top" style="cursor:pointer">
Abattement gérant majoritaire
</a>
</div>
</div>
</div>
</div>
</div>
答案 0 :(得分:2)
<a>
是元素,而不是类属性。您不想在其前面加上点.
。
您尝试了吗?
$(function () {
$("a.mdc-list-item:first").on("click", function (event) {
event.preventDefault();
console.log($(this).html());
});
});
答案 1 :(得分:0)
我不清楚您的意思,如果您想选择第一个元素,可以在函数中使用此代码,
$(function () {
$(".mdc-list-item:first-child").css("background-color", "yellow");
$(".mdc-list-item:first-child").on("click", function (event) {
event.preventDefault();
});
});
如果您不问这个,请告诉我您的需要
答案 2 :(得分:0)
仅使用CSS创建活动类
final
将此课程添加到您的第一个标签
<class-name>.<method-name>
要删除类,请使用此功能为除第一个
之外的所有链接添加click事件。 android:inputType="textCapCharacters|textNoSuggestions"